Harry Kane scored twice as Tottenham cruised into the fifth round of the FA Cup following a 3-1 victory over Brighton on Saturday evening.

Kane opened the scoring with an excellent finish into the top corner before Emerson Royal’s deflected cross doubled Spurs’ advantage.

Yves Bissouma’s deflected effort briefly got Brighton back into the contest, but Kane restored Tottenham’s two goal lead less than three minutes later when he poked in from close-range.

Kane’s first was a measured finish into the far corner after the Seagulls were caught out playing out from the back.

Royal then made it 2-0 when his cross deflected in off Solomon March and somehow found the far corner. Unfortunately for the Brazilian, while he wheeled off in celebration, the goal was credited as an own goal, meaning his wait for his first goal in English football goes on.

Kane then got his second and Spurs’ third when the ball fell kindly for him inside the six yard box.
